Upstairs at Town Hall presents a performance by iconic folk singer, historian, educator and civil rights activist Reggie Harris.
As a descendant of an enslaved Black woman and a Confederate general, Harris has embraced his unique heritage to create profound and beautiful music about diverse subjects, ranging from building community, to the history of the Underground Railroad, and interpretations of the work of wonderful songwriters like John Prine and Pete Seeger.
